titleOfInvention |
Method for Production of Single-Stranded Macronucleotides |
abstract |
The invention relates to a method for production of single-stranded macronucleotides by amplifying and ligating an extended monomeric single-stranded target nucleic acid sequence (target ss ) into a repetitive cluster of double-stranded target nucleic acid sequences (target ds ), and subsequently cloning the construct into a vector (aptagene vector). The aptagene vector is transformed into host cells for replication of the aptagene and isolated in order to optain single-stranded target sequences (target ss ). The invention also relates to single-stranded nucleic acids, produced by a method of the invention. |
